So, 'Tu Hovein Main Hovan' really dives into this slice-of-life scenario that feels all too real. You've got Sukhi and Tania, young lovers with that carefree vibe, but then there's Garry and Kelly, who are knee-deep in the chaos of parenthood and work life. The pacing's a bit uneven, but it captures that grind of everyday life—like, you really empathize with the struggles of juggling family and career. The performances have this rawness, especially from the leads; they really nail the emotional weight of contemplating separation. And while the comedy isn't over-the-top, it has these little moments that hit home. It's not flashy, but there's a certain charm in its honesty about love and the toll life can take on relationships.
